1. Washington: Here’s what the Huskies got with new coordinators Justin Wilcox (defense/Tennessee) and Eric Kiesau (offense/California): two of the bright young minds in the game, and two elite recruiters. Both will eventually be head coaches.
Coach Steve Sarkisian also convinced Tosh Lupoi (defensive line/Cal), the best recruiter on the West Coast, to leave two weeks before signing day, and Peter Sirmon (linebackers/Tennessee)—who had quickly developed into the Vols’ best recruiter—to return home to his native Washington.
Sarkisian fired defensive coordnator Nick Holt, and lost offensive coordinator Doug Nussmeier to Alabama. But the net gain was a staff that can recruit and coach the Huskies into the elite of the Pac-12. -
